Recently I've noticed a number of S2000 antennas being sold on Ebay. Apparently they fit other makes of cars too.
Has anybody here had their's stolen?
If so, do you know if there's a way to prevent it from happening again?

If you apply RED loctite #71 to the antenna threads, no one will be removing it without a major battle.
If someone complains to Ebay, they will probably stop the sales of the antennas. Seems Ebay is kinda senitive to becoming a major fencing outfit.
